But what does installing a solar panel essentially cost in Dubai? The solar panel price in Dubai may differ widely, hinging upon a host of factors—from system size and equipment to installation costs.

Firstly, the size of the system strongly impacts the solar panel Dubai price. In general terms, a larger capacity system demands a more significant overall investment. A one-kilowatt (kW) system may set an owner back around AED 5,000-7,000. Assuming that the average UAE household uses a 5 kW system, the approximate total puts somewhere between AED 25,000 and AED 35,000.

Next, the equipment used in the system also affects the solar panel price Dubai. Take for example, mono-crystalline solar panels—known for their efficiency and sleek design—tend to carry a loftier price tag compared to poly-crystalline or thin-film panels.

The third key factor that plays into the equation is the cost of fixing up the system. Various prerequisites, such as securing necessary permits and hiring professional installers, will add to the overall solar panel UAE price. However, it is indeed a one-time expense that will result in substantial savings over time.

Despite the upfront cost, the benefits of installing a solar panel in the UAE far outstrip the prices. Maintenance costs are minimal, and the drastic reduction in electricity bills over time will enable the system to pay for itself in a span of 5 to 6 years.
